PHP网站开发
是当前最流行和广泛应用的开发技术之一。借助PHP技术,开发人员能够轻松构建出全功能的网站和应用程序,并且这个过程是相当快捷和简便的。下面我们来探讨一下的深层次原理和实际应用。
一. PHP的优势
PHP是一种跨平台支持的脚本语言,在开发网站和网络应用程序时具有多种优势。首先,它是一种开源技术,可以免费使用,这减轻了开发人员的负担。其次,PHP易于学习和掌握,具有一套简单且易于理解的语法规则和数据类型,使得初学者能够很快领悟其基本用法。此外,它还提供了完整的操作系统支持和庞大的程序库,为开发人员提供了丰富的编程工具和资源。中文版php开发工具
二. 网站应用的架构
PHP网站应用程序的架构通常由三个部分组成:客户端、服务器脚本和数据库。客户端通常是指用户使用的浏览器,服务器脚本则是通过PHP语言实现的,用于生成HTML页面并与用
户交互。在这个过程中,服务器脚本与数据库交互,以及存储和获取数据。这个架构提供了一种有效的方式,用于创建动态Web内容和应用程序,同时确保其性能和安全性。
三. 的关键技术
涉及到许多关键技术,这些技术不仅对整个开发过程至关重要,而且对最终的应用程序质量和用户体验有深远的影响。以下是几种最重要的技术:
1. 数据库设计: 数据库设计是Web应用程序成功的关键因素之一。在PHP应用程序中,数据库设计通常是通过MySQL或PostgreSQL等关系型数据库实现的,这些数据库具有高效数据存储和检索功能。为确保稳健性,开发人员需要精心设计数据库结构和设计规范,以确保应用程序能够实现最佳性能和安全性。
2. HTML和CSS的使用: HTML和CSS是客户端Web开发的必要工具。开发人员需要精通HTML语言,以确保Web应用制作正确的标记和结构。与此同时,CSS语言则增加了样式和设计元素,使用户界面更加美观和易于浏览。在网络设计中,特别是在响应式Web设计中,使用这些技术可以大大改善用户体验。
3. AJAX的应用: AJAX是用于异步操作的Web开发技术。开发人员可以利用AJAX技术加载和更新Web页面,实现动态Web内容,提高用户体验。并且,AJAX技术可以与PHP和JavaScript结合使用,生成高性能的Web应用程序。
4. 安全设置和控制: 在开发Web应用程序时,安全是至关重要的问题,这涉及到身份验证,密码保护,数据加密等方面。特别是在PHP应用中,开发人员需要识别和控制潜在的安全漏洞,从而确保用户数据的安全性。
四. 的工具
除了PHP语言以外,开发人员还需要使用许多其他的开发工具和资源,如集成开发环境,代码库,调试工具等。以下是几种重要的工具:
1. Eclipse: Eclipse是一种流行的开发环境,用于PHP语言和其他Web开发平台。它提供了各种技术支持和资源,包括代码编辑,错误检测,Debug工具等。
2. PhpStorm: PhpStorm是一款专门设计的PHP开发工具,它提供了更高级的调试和分析功能,可以极大地提高Web应用程序的开发效率和质量。
3. Git和GitHub: Git是一种流行的版本控制软件,可用于跟踪和管理代码的变化。而GitHub则是一个为程序员和开发人员提供的合作平台和代码共享社区。
4. Composer: Composer是一种PHP包管理工具,用于管理和安装与PHP应用程序相关的包和依赖项。它可以使开发人员更容易地跟踪和管理PHP应用程序的不同模块。
五. 的未来
作为一种现代Web开发技术至关重要并不断发展和改进。新的PHP版本和组件的开发,将极大地增强PHP的功能和性能,从而提高Web应用程序的质量和用户体验。与此同时,各种新的Web技术,如HTML5,CSS3,JavaScript框架等也在不断发展和改进。这些技术成为不断发展的网络生态系统的一部分,将提供更多丰富和多样化的Web应用程序和体验。
六. 结论
是一种灵活且广泛应用的开发技术,其应用范围和变化的需求与网络的不断发展相适应。贯彻安全性原则和使用完整的开发工具和资源,将有助于开发人员构建出高质量的Web应用程序,从而为用户提供更优秀的体验。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论